groupchat says outgoing and wont work

One of my group chats stopped working correctly. It says "outgoing" where the names were and any texts I send and receive show up as separate threads instead of in the group chat. Any ideas how I can fix this?

Based on what you stated, it seems you are having issues with a group message thread in the Messages app and that replies are going into separate threads. If you haven't already, please force close the Messages app and restart your iPhone as the shut down and start up process is important to keep the iOS software running properly. iOS clears cached data and does other system optimizations when you turn your device off and on. Then test your issue again. Also, does this thread have only have iPhone users, or do some of the contacts in the thread also use Android phones? Please let us know as these details could help.

If you have issues with a group message

You might reply to a group conversation and receive your own message. Or you might get a new phone number and see your old one listed as a recipient in an existing group conversation. If you have issues with a group message, you might need to delete the conversation and start a new one. Follow these steps:

  1. Open Messages and find the conversation you want to delete.
  2. Swipe left over the conversation, then tap Delete.

After you delete the group conversation, start a new one:

  1. Open Messages and tap User uploaded file.
  2. Enter the phone numbers or email addresses of your contacts.
  3. Write a new message, then tap Send.

When you delete a conversation, you can't recover it. If you want to save parts of a conversation, take a screenshot. To save an attachment in a conversation, touch and hold the attachment, tap More, then tap Save.
